Let’s just come out and say it: Yesterday was garbage!
The Chargers offense sputtered on Sunday afternoon in a game where it flat out shouldn’t have. Justin Herbert threw for under 200 yards for just the third time in his career (second in the past four games) against a bottom-five defense that was missing almost half of its’ starters.
Defensively, the Chargers got the Vikings into plenty of uncomfortable situations but couldn’t finish the job and allowed too many conversions on pivotal third downs. I liked their effort in that game, but when it mattered most, they couldn’t get it done.
Lastly, the Vikings were penalized three more times on the night for an additional 66 more yards than the Chargers and yet it didn’t do much to keep the Vikings from pulling this one out.
